Output 8d17f982ee74198be569ca71ed1fd9fc226f888b85465696faaf97a082168108:0

value
80639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57660b48dc9f4a5f6d2a90d0463c0aae7258946d OP_EQUAL
address
39f8xNzd2DL67rLTd22QoHsZH3wXPojUQq
transaction
8d17f982ee74198be569ca71ed1fd9fc226f888b85465696faaf97a082168108
spent
true